Abstract: |
A field-walking survey of two fields totalling 14ha was undertaken ahead of mineral extraction. Few prehistoric or medieval finds were recovered, and none of Romano-British or early medieval date were found. Concentrations of slag and ironstone, often in association with burnt flint, were suggestive of processing activity on the site in addition to the extraction of raw materials. The presence of glass-working slag may have represented evidence of activity, but was not conclusive. Quantities of post-medieval and modern material had been introduced to the site with manuring or dumping. [Au(abr)] |
